Output d66bd31208751446f2cf3bc919644bbe8bdc2b28987dabd074d1cce53f21520a:3

value
274831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55e07ba5e2d202985f5189862d14df7745e81a62 OP_EQUAL
address
39X6HCeVcoBbNArx3gswJ21w1ZpaPHGcuJ
transaction
d66bd31208751446f2cf3bc919644bbe8bdc2b28987dabd074d1cce53f21520a
spent
true